Relationship between Ms and mb for Small Earthquakes in Uzbekistan, USSR

Abstract

The SRO station MAIO was used to obtain many measurements of P sub and LR from a sequence of aftershocks at Gazli, Uzbekistan in 1976, at a distance of 576 km. SP periods and amplitudes are analyzed to obtain the proper distance correction factor to yield m sub b. Eighteen events are measured to give an M sub s range 2.2 to 3.6, and m sub b range 3.6 to 5.0. The observations support the postulation that delta M sub s/delta M sub b is approximately equal 1 to at low magnitudes. The Gazli population overlaps a Eurasian teleseismic population, and is believed to be free of large error in determination of M sub s and m sub b.
